    Google Media Server

    Well, it now appears Google is jumping into the mix and released a Media Server. The details on this are slim, but here is a quote from labnol.org "This requires a Universal Plug and Play compatible device like an Xbox or Playstation gaming console, set-top box or a photo frame like the Kodak EasyShare."It runs in the Google desktop.http://desktop.google.com/plugins/i/mediaserver.html?hl=en

    I must admit this is a very poor feature set, but maybe if Google appears to be junping into the market it will kickstart Microsoft into the right gear and put Media Center down the correct path.
